Davies appeal dismissed

Bolton striker Kevin Davies had his appeal for a wrongful dismissal rejected by the Football Association on Thursday.

Davies will serve a three-match ban. He was sent off in Bolton's match against Charlton last Saturday after he elbowed Abdoulaye Faye in the face in an aerial challenge.

Davies had earlier been caught by the swinging elbow of Charlton defender Hermann Hreidarsson. That left Davies with a depressed fractured cheekbone.

That injury is expected to rule Davies out until October.
